Question 07 cobalt speedometer head instrument cluster gauges panel

My 2007 Chevy Cobalt SS speedometer, tachometer and fuel gauges change to a different location every time the car is turned on. One time they will be good, the next they will be off by 5 MPH or more. Is there a way to fix this problem?

Sounds like a wiring issue. Try checking and making sure all the grounds from your harness have good contact. The check the fuse for the instrument cluster. Couldn't tell you without looking at the car in person.
